About the Smokefree Councillor Network

A cross-party group of elected members committed to achieving comprehensive local government action on tobacco

The Smokefree Councillor Network is a cross-party group of elected members working together to deliver strong local action on tobacco and eliminate the harm it causes in local communities.

The Network’s aims are aligned with the Local Government Declaration on Tobacco Control, committing councillors and local authorities to take meaningful action to address the harms caused by smoking.

Network members receive semi-regular updates on tobacco control activity and public health campaigns, including:

  • Updates on key developments in tobacco control
  • Invitations to sign open letters and support campaigning activity
  • Briefings and resources to support local tobacco control work
